The Graphic Genius of Max Ernst: Beyond Painting
While Ernst's paintings like The Elephant Celebes or Europe After the Rain are iconic, his contributions to printmaking and illustration are equally profound. His graphic works, often created through experimental methods, reveal a meticulous attention to texture and detail that translates remarkably well into high-quality reproductions. Ernst's 1929 novel La Femme 100 Têtes, illustrated with 124 collages, demonstrates how he blurred lines between visual and literary art. PDF archives of such works allow viewers to study his intricate layering and symbolic narratives up close, something impossible in traditional gallery settings.
These digital formats preserve the subtleties of his frottage technique, where rubbings from textured surfaces created ghostly, organic forms. What are some key techniques in Max Ernst's art visible in PDFs?
PDFs can highlight techniques such as frottage (rubbing textures), grattage (scraping paint), and decalcomania (pressing paint between surfaces). These methods created surreal, organic forms that are easier to study in digital formats due to zoom capabilities.
